SUBJECTS OF LIS/GIS INTO THE INSTRUCTION OF PHOTOGRAMMETRY AND REMOTE SENSING 
Patmios E. Professor, 
Laboratory of Photogrammetry-Remote Sensing 
Dept. of Civil Engineers Polytechnic School 
Aristotle University of Thessaloniki GREECE 
Lasaridou M., Surveyor 
Commission VI 
ABSTRACT 
At first a general analysis of the content of LIS and GIS takes place. 
Critical research for a suitable combination of instruction of subjects of LIS/GIS with Photogrammetry and 
Remote Sensing follows. 
The facing of the subject takes place mainly from the point of instruction, research and applications.in 
the frame of Civil Engineer ’s requirements (it concerns the Department of Civil Engineers of the Polyte- 
chnic School in Aristotle University of Thessaloniki). 
1. INTRODUCTION 
LIS/GIS nowadays have wide dissemination. 
Considerations as well applications concerning 
them are many sided. 
Among others, the purpose of each LIS/GIS is a 
determinative factor for the whole planning. 
Interrelations of the possibilities of LIS/GIS 
with different scientific and technologic directi- 
ons are of particular importance. 
Relatively to Photogrammetry and Remote Sensing 
the interest is continously growing. 
In the context of University courses the above 
gain great importance. 
In this paper we refer relatively to the Depart- 
ment of Civil Engineers in Aristotle University 
of Thessaloniki. 
In this Department from the academic year 1986-87 
the following subjects were introduced and are be- 
ing instructed 
Photogrammetry and 
Photointerpretation Remote Sensing Geoinformation 
Systems. 
Relevant observations to the activities in these 
Scientific directions (subjects that are being 
instructed, diplomas, thesis, research etc.) were 
presented in the past (5). 
The Department of Civil Engineers includes the 
following divisions: 
Structural Engineering 
Hydraulics and environmental Engineering 
Transport and Organization and 
Geotechnical Engineering. 
Many objects of these divisions have the necessi- 
ty to be served by the possibilities of LIS/GIS. 
This, of course, can be done without referring to 
Photogrammetry and Remote Sensing. 
What we are interested in and consists the subject

of this paper is the cooperation-combination of 
Photogrammetry-Remote Sensing with LIS/GIS and 
furthermore the combined contribution to the study 
of subjects that the above four divisions are in- 
terested in. 
From this point of view a suitable revision of (5) 
concerning teaching subjects is being done emphasi- 
zing on several-specific subjects. 
2. ASPECTS CONCERNING THE COMBINATION OF LIS/GIS 
TO THE INSTRUCTION OF PHOTOGRAMMETRY AND REMOTE 
SENSING 
2.1 The above purpose is faced mainly on the base 
of the following necessities-factors-directions: 
-Developing requirements of the country (at natio- 
nal and local level). 
-Particularities of the Greek area (natural and 
cultural environment). 
-Location and study of the areas of interest of the 
divisions in the Dept. of Civil Engineers that may 
be served by the combination of Photogrammetry- 
Remote Sensing with LIS/GIS. 
-Considerations relatively to the structure and the 
applications of LIS/GIS. 
-Directions of developing methods and equipment of 
Photogrammetry-Remote Sensing. 
-Other relevant techologic evolutions (computers 
etc). 
-Experience from the instruction of Photogrammetry 
and Remote Sensing in the Dept. of Civil Engineers. 
2.2 The above compose determinative factors to the 
formation of the teaching framework of Photogram- 
metry-Remote Sensing and LIS/GIS, concerning their 
combination-cooperation to face better the subjects 
of the divisions in the Dept. of Civil Engineers. 
Data, Software and Hardware can be considered as 
the basic parts of LIS/GIS. 
In this phase, we are interested mainly in Data, 
that is, for the formation of a teaching framework 
of subjects of Photogrammetry-Remote Sensing that 
can serve the acquisition of suitable data accord- 
ing to the intentions.
